Output e4cf59890b1ea27571ef17b1c31f848f937836bf1c68f23695b0b95c45d27732:144

value
31446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c237e43a1387a352ec5423f2bda47d0a6b8d078 OP_EQUAL
address
3BYoRNcukC7cmVv6CtcyFx95BfNTLaoB3A
transaction
e4cf59890b1ea27571ef17b1c31f848f937836bf1c68f23695b0b95c45d27732
spent
true